Which is why I like to back up my important data to a
USB type drive which goes into my file cabinet where
nothing can access it.

I also have two USB sticks. Once a week when I update
my data I then copy the latest data onto both sticks.

(Periodically copying off the data then storing another
external USB drive with the data 'off site' is another
good practice if 'loss of data' could be catastrophic.)
